Dear Teacher is all about celebrating the teachers in our lives. Each episode features an interview with a teacher (K-12 and Higher Ed too) sharing the joys and challenges of the classroom, favorite moments, funny stories, and tips for appreciating the teachers in your own life.

    Anne and Chrissie: A Homeschool Conversation

    For the final episode of Dear Teacher I interviewed two of my very first interviewees, Anne Grogan and Chrissie Lockman. Anne and Chrissie are both trained elementary school teachers turned homeschool moms who are passionate about education. In this interview they trade stories about out-of-the-box teaching ideas, how to survive the stress of homeschooling, and how to practice grace and good self-care.
